Unlocking Johto: The Truth About "Pokémon Heart Gold QR Codes" and How to Get Rare Pokémon Legally
If you’ve been searching for a "Pokémon Heart Gold QR Code," you’ve likely stumbled into one of the most confusing corners of the Pokémon fandom. You may have seen YouTube videos promising rare event Pokémon—like Celebi, Mew, or a Shiny Legendary Beasts—simply by scanning a black-and-white square with your 3DS camera.
Here is the hard truth you need to know immediately: Pokémon Heart Gold (released in 2010 for the Nintendo DS) does not natively support QR codes. QR code functionality was not introduced until the Nintendo 3DS era, specifically with Pokémon Sun & Moon (2016) and the Pokémon Bank app.
So why are thousands of fans still searching for "Pokémon Heart Gold QR codes"? And more importantly, how can you actually get those rare, unobtainable Pokémon in your Johto adventure today?
This article will debunk the myths, explain the technology, and provide the only legitimate (and safe) methods to unlock the content you are really looking for.
Tips and best practices
- Use a clear, bright screen or a high‑quality printout for reliable scanning. Avoid glare.
- If the DS has trouble reading a code, adjust distance and angle slowly; ensure the camera lens is clean.
- Archive scanned QR images (screenshots or prints) so you can reuse them if needed.
- Join retro Pokémon communities or forums to find curated collections of QR codes and Pokéwalker courses preserved by fans.
Conclusion
QR codes in Pokémon HeartGold provide a small but fun way to extend the Pokéwalker experience and access some promotional content. While limited by hardware and the discontinuation of many official events, QR scanning remains a useful feature for players using camera‑equipped DS systems. For those looking to explore more, retro Pokémon communities are the best place to find archived QR codes and instructions.
Related search suggestions sent.
While Pokémon HeartGold (2009) was originally released for the Nintendo DS and did not natively feature QR code functionality, the modern "Pokémon HeartGold QR Code" topic typically refers to community-driven methods for accessing the game on modern hardware or using it within newer generations. 1. Game Installation via QR Codes (3DS Homebrew)
For users with a modified (homebrewed) Nintendo 3DS, QR codes are a common way to install the game or its patches directly onto the console without a computer.
The "H-Shop" & Remote Install: Custom firmware users often use apps like FBI to scan QR codes that trigger a remote installation of the game's .cia file.
Twilight Menu++: This is the primary interface for playing DS games on a 3DS. QR codes found in communities like r/3dsqrcodes often provide direct links to updated versions of the game or its "Heart & Soul" patches. 2. QR Codes in Later Generations (Gen 7)
Although HeartGold doesn't use QR codes, the games that followed—specifically Pokémon Sun, Moon, Ultra Sun, and Ultra Moon—introduced a "QR Scanner" feature.
Island Scan: You can scan any QR code (including those generated for HeartGold-exclusive Pokémon) to gain points in the QR Scanner. Once you reach 100 points, you can use Island Scan to find rare Pokémon, some of which are Johto-region natives originally from HeartGold.
Magearna Event: A specific, permanent QR code exists for these games to unlock the Mythical Pokémon Magearna. 3. Modern Pokémon TCG & Digital Apps
If your query relates to the physical card game or modern mobile apps:
TCG Code Cards: Modern Pokémon Trading Card Game packs (even those themed after classic Johto sets) include Code Cards with QR codes to redeem digital packs in Pokémon TCG Live.
Pokémon Bank: Official QR codes provided by Nintendo Support can take you directly to the download page for services like Pokémon Bank, which is used to transfer Pokémon from older titles. Summary of Differences
Limitations and compatibility notes
- Hardware requirement: scanning requires a DS model with a camera (DSi/3DS). Original DS and DS Lite cannot scan.
- Region and event restrictions: many official distributions were region‑locked or time‑limited; not every promotional code will work for all copies or regions.
- Modern preservation: official servers and modern event distribution have mostly ended; many original QR code sources are offline. Fan communities and archived scans are often the only available sources today.
- Security and authenticity: unofficial QR images may not be trustworthy—malformed images simply won’t scan or may produce unexpected in‑game results. There’s no risk of malware to the DS, but always prefer reputable sources.
⚠️ Important warnings
- Downloading ROMs via QR codes from random sites risks bricking your device or stealing personal data.
- Piracy discussion isn't allowed in many communities.
2. Action Replay Code Generation (Indirectly)
Some online databases use QR codes to represent long Action Replay or GameShark cheat codes. For example, a "Wild Modifier" code might be 30 lines long. A website can generate a QR code that, when scanned, decodes to that text string. You then copy the decoded text and manually enter it into your Action Replay device. Again, the QR is merely a data carrier, not a direct game modifier.
How to scan QR codes in HeartGold
- The Nintendo DS has a built‑in camera on the DS Lite and DSi models; HeartGold uses the system’s interface to read QR patterns displayed on another screen or printed on paper.
- To scan: open the in‑game QR scanner function (found in the Pokédex/related menu), align the code displayed on the opposite device or printout within the DS camera frame, and wait for confirmation. Successful scans import or register the encoded Pokémon data.
3. Sharing "DNS Exploit" Server Addresses
For players using the fan-made DNS exploit (which reactivates online events like the Sinjoh Ruins or the Enigma Stone), you must manually enter a custom DNS server number into your DS's Wi-Fi settings. Some guides provide a QR code that contains this numeric address (e.g., 172.104.88.237). Scanning it saves you from typing the digits. After scanning, you still need to launch HeartGold and connect to the fan server to receive the event.